Pros
I have never worked at a place that puts as much emphasis on career progression and succession planning. Naturally, the best opportunities go to the highest performers.
Cons
Built on acquisitions, Ingersoll Rand struggles with the various histories of predecessor companies. Employees identify themselves with the old brands and old decisions which is a challenge to making decisions that effect all the businesses under the umbrella. The pay is decent but not terrific until one becomes eligible for performance and management bonuses, but still lags compared to other major companies, particularly in the Charlotte metropolitan area.
